Statement from Senate President Pro Tem David Long regarding the Child Welfare Policy and Practice Group’s (CWG) assessment of the Indiana Department of Child Services

Indiana Senate President Pro Tem David Long (R-Fort Wayne) made the following statement today regarding the Child Welfare Policy and Practice Group’s (CWG) assessment of the Indiana Department of Child Services:

STATEHOUSE (June 18, 2018) ― “Today we learned from the experts at CWG that though the Indiana Department of Child Services is staffed by Hoosiers who are clearly dedicated to the welfare of the children they serve, there are structural and policy issues that are making the job of a caseworker more and more difficult to manage.

“This assessment will provide the information we need as lawmakers to take measured and well-informed action to benefit DCS and the extremely vulnerable population it serves. My thanks go out to Gov. Holcomb for his leadership on this issue – requesting an in-depth audit of this long-troubled agency was the right call, and I commend the governor taking immediate action to address some of these issues.”
